1. Define Your Goals

Digital marketing provides numerous tools and tactics that can help reach your desired audience, but before beginning any of these strategies it’s essential that you set goals.

Defined marketing goals will provide direction and a measurable framework to help achieve them, as well as ensure your efforts align with overall business objectives.

When setting marketing goals, it’s essential that they be as specific as possible. Instead of saying “I want to expand my business”, try saying: “I aim to increase organic traffic by 50% annually.” This allows you to track your progress more effectively and ensures your goals are realistic and obtainable. Be sure to set an end date so as to hold yourself accountable!

2. Understand Your Target Audience

Understanding your target audience is at the core of any digital marketing strategy, as this enables you to craft content that resonates with them and drives conversions. To do this effectively, it’s essential that you can identify their demographic characteristics, needs and goals, location etc.

Conduct market research and observe your competitors to gain an edge. Gain more knowledge about your audience by discovering their interests – hobbies or entertainment preferences for instance.

By understanding your target audience, you can avoid spending money on campaigns that won’t generate results for your business and maximize ROI. Furthermore, being open to reassessing target audiences as necessary – like when releasing new products – ensures your marketing efforts always focus on those most appropriate for them.

Social media provides one of the best ways to engage with your target audience. Responding to comments or questions shows customers you care about them and their concerns while simultaneously building trust between yourself and them.

Engagement can also be increased by capitalizing on trending topics. This tactic works particularly well during holidays or sporting events when your audience may be more engaged in certain subjects. Trending topics could range from politics, pop culture or sports; find creative ways of incorporating these trends into your business strategy!
